NIAGARA FALLS, N.Y. - Niagara scored three power play goals on its way to defeating the Rensselaer men's hockey team, 4-1, for its first victory of the season. The Purple Eagles improve to 1-8-2, while the Engineers are now 7-5-2. Senior Paul Kerins scored for RPI, who got 25 saves from sophomore Allen York.

Researchers at Rensselaer Polytechnic Institute have developed a tabletop accelerator that produces nuclear fusion at room temperature, providing confirmation of an earlier experiment conducted at the University of California, Los Angeles (UCLA), while offering substantial improvements over the original design.
